It's very difficult to ever set parameters for movies that play with space/time so that viewers can convince themselves it is still somehow logical, but for me this one worked pretty well by using the concept of parallel universes to allow for things that would otherwise simply not jive. This concept of going back over and over to effect a change based on knowledge gathered from previous trips back through time and space worked much the way it did in groundhog day but with a much shorter time frame to work with. Also, this movie was all serious business and a touch of romance that I also felt worked quite well. Good time all in all.
